The Non Nobis is a hymn or prayer used by the Knights Templar as thanksgiving and an expression of humility. The prayer comes from Psalm 115:1 and reads: Non Nobis, Non Nobis, Domine Sed nomini tuo da gloriam and means "Not to us, Not to us, O Lord, but to your name give glory".
